Skip to content

Rename TypeMeta function pointers#12306

Closed
smessmer wants to merge 206 commits intomasterfrom
export-D10184117
Closed

Rename TypeMeta function pointers#12306
smessmer wants to merge 206 commits intomasterfrom
export-D10184117

Conversation

@smessmer
Copy link
Copy Markdown
Contributor

@smessmer smessmer commented Oct 3, 2018

Stack:
    :black_circle:  #12306 Rename TypeMeta function pointers  💚
    :white_circle:  #12307 Add TypeMeta::New/Delete  💚
    :white_circle:  #11500 Use TypeMeta::dtor() instead of Blob::DestroyCall  💚
    :white_circle:  #11925 Serialization takes pointers instead of Blob  💚
    :white_circle:  #11926 Remove Blob::ShareExternal from serialization  💚

In a future diff, I'm going to introduce non-placement constructor and destructor to TypeMeta.
To make it less ambigous, this diff is first renaming the existing ones to PlacementXXX.

Differential Revision: D10184117

Differential Revision: D9623916
Differential Version: 56705898
Differential Revision: D9623916
Differential Version: 56858422
Differential Revision: D9644700
Differential Version: 56870160
Differential Revision: D9623916
Differential Version: 56900314
Differential Revision: D9644700
Differential Version: 56900331
Differential Revision: D9652088
Differential Version: 56917655
Differential Revision: D9652088
Differential Version: 56918713
Differential Revision: D9652089
Differential Version: 56918714
Differential Revision: D9623916
Differential Version: 56982469
Differential Revision: D9644700
Differential Version: 56982494
Differential Revision: D9652088
Differential Version: 56982465
Differential Revision: D9652089
Differential Version: 56982470
Differential Revision: D9663476
Differential Version: 56982467
Differential Revision: D9623916
Differential Version: 57101548
Differential Revision: D9644700
Differential Version: 57101652
Differential Revision: D9652088
Differential Version: 57101545
Differential Revision: D9652089
Differential Version: 57101550
Differential Revision: D9663476
Differential Version: 57101556
Differential Revision: D9623916
Differential Version: 57135223
Differential Revision: D9644700
Differential Version: 57135224
Differential Revision: D9652088
Differential Version: 57135218
Differential Revision: D9652089
Differential Version: 57135219
Differential Revision: D9663476
Differential Version: 57135226
Differential Revision: D9694327
Differential Version: 57135227
Differential Revision: D9694326
Differential Version: 57135216
Differential Revision: D9694918
Differential Version: 57140103
Differential Revision: D9623916
Differential Version: 57214033
Differential Revision: D9644700
Differential Version: 57214023
Differential Revision: D9652088
Differential Version: 57214005
Differential Revision: D9652089
Differential Version: 57214030
Differential Revision: D9763422
Differential Version: 59872623
Differential Revision: D9763422
Differential Version: 59874179
Differential Revision: D9763422
Differential Version: 59875467
Differential Revision: D9763422
Differential Version: 59876674
Differential Revision: D9763422
Differential Version: 59879239
Differential Revision: D9763422
Differential Version: 59882454
Differential Revision: D9763422
Differential Version: 59883487
Differential Revision: D9763422
Differential Version: 59886110
Differential Revision: D9763422
Differential Version: 59890579
Differential Revision: D9763422
Differential Version: 59898430
Differential Revision: D9763422
Differential Version: 59902014
Differential Revision: D9763422
Differential Version: 59910282
Differential Revision: D10139933
Differential Version: 59930646
Differential Revision: D10139935
Differential Version: 59930643
Differential Revision: D10139934
Differential Version: 59930644
Differential Revision: D10184117
Differential Version: 59930642
Differential Revision: D10139933
Differential Version: 60109134
Differential Revision: D10139935
Differential Version: 60109133
Differential Revision: D10139934
Differential Version: 60109128
Differential Revision: D10184117
Differential Version: 60109130
Differential Revision: D10184117
Differential Version: 60766870
@smessmer smessmer changed the base branch from export-D10139934 to master October 16, 2018 10:01
Differential Revision: D10184117
Differential Version: 60767839
zdevito pushed a commit to zdevito/ATen that referenced this pull request Oct 17, 2018
Summary:
Pull Request resolved: pytorch/pytorch#12306

In a future diff, I'm going to introduce non-placement constructor and destructor to TypeMeta.
To make it less ambigous, this diff is first renaming the existing ones to PlacementXXX.

Reviewed By: dzhulgakov

Differential Revision: D10184117

fbshipit-source-id: 119120ebc718048bdc1d66e0cc4d6a7840e666a4
@soumith soumith deleted the export-D10184117 branch February 21, 2019 23:24
@ezyang ezyang added the merged label Jun 26, 2019
laurentdupin pushed a commit to laurentdupin/pytorch that referenced this pull request Apr 24, 2026
Summary:
Pull Request resolved: pytorch#12306

In a future diff, I'm going to introduce non-placement constructor and destructor to TypeMeta.
To make it less ambigous, this diff is first renaming the existing ones to PlacementXXX.

Reviewed By: dzhulgakov

Differential Revision: D10184117

fbshipit-source-id: 119120ebc718048bdc1d66e0cc4d6a7840e666a4
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ants